$60, www.mountainhardwear.com

With the Fluid Race Vest, one of its 2012 debut hydration systems, Mountain Hardwear hit a home run. While you’ll have to supply your own bladder (we recommend the CamelBak 50-ounce Antidote reservoir), the vest is so lightweight we could hardly tell that we had it on. It has enough room for essentials: front mesh pockets large enough to store a few gels and a smart phone, and a backside shock cord for an extra layer or two. One drawback: the vest hits shelves this spring with only one size (fits most), but Mountain Hardwear plans to add another size next year. Petite runners might experience unwanted side-to-side swaying.
